<?php
declare(strict_types=1);
namespace Rector\EarlyReturn\Rector\StmtsAwareInterface;
use PhpParser\Node;
use PhpParser\Node\Expr;
use PhpParser\Node\Expr\Assign;
use PhpParser\Node\Expr\Variable;
use PhpParser\Node\Stmt;
use PhpParser\Node\Stmt\Expression;
use PhpParser\Node\Stmt\If_;
use PhpParser\Node\Stmt\Return_;
use Rector\Core\Contract\PhpParser\Node\StmtsAwareInterface;
use Rector\Core\Rector\AbstractRector;
use Symplify\RuleDocGenerator\ValueObject\CodeSample\CodeSample;
use Symplify\RuleDocGenerator\ValueObject\RuleDefinition;
/**
* @see \Rector\Tests\EarlyReturn\Rector\StmtsAwareInterface\ReturnEarlyIfVariableRector\ReturnEarlyIfVariableRectorTest
*/
final class ReturnEarlyIfVariableRector extends AbstractRector
{
public function getRuleDefinition(): RuleDefinition
{
return new RuleDefinition('Replace if conditioned variable override with direct return', [
new CodeSample(
<<<'CODE_SAMPLE'
final class SomeClass
{
public function run($value)
{
if ($value === 50) {
$value = 100;
}
return $value;
}
}
CODE_SAMPLE
,
<<<'CODE_SAMPLE'
final class SomeClass
{
public function run($value)
{
if ($value === 50) {
return 100;
}
return $value;
}
}
CODE_SAMPLE
),
]);
}
/**
* @return array<class-string<Node>>
*/
public function getNodeTypes(): array
{
return [StmtsAwareInterface::class];
}
/**
* @param StmtsAwareInterface $node
*/
public function refactor(Node $node): ?Node
{
$stmts = (array) $node->stmts;
foreach ($stmts as $key => $stmt) {
$returnVariable = $this->matchNextStmtReturnVariable($node, $key);
if (! $returnVariable instanceof Variable) {
continue;
}
if ($stmt instanceof If_ && $stmt->else === null && $stmt->elseifs === []) {
// is single condition if
$if = $stmt;
if (count($if->stmts) !== 1) {
continue;
}
$onlyIfStmt = $if->stmts[0];
$assignedExpr = $this->matchOnlyIfStmtReturnExpr($onlyIfStmt, $returnVariable);
if (! $assignedExpr instanceof Expr) {
continue;
}
$if->stmts[0] = new Return_($assignedExpr);
return $node;
}
}
return null;
}
private function matchOnlyIfStmtReturnExpr(Stmt $onlyIfStmt, Variable $returnVariable): Expr|null
{
if (! $onlyIfStmt instanceof Expression) {
return null;
}
if (! $onlyIfStmt->expr instanceof Assign) {
return null;
}
$assign = $onlyIfStmt->expr;
// assign to same variable that is returned
if (! $assign->var instanceof Variable) {
return null;
}
if (! $this->nodeComparator->areNodesEqual($assign->var, $returnVariable)) {
return null;
}
// return directly
return $assign->expr;
}
private function matchNextStmtReturnVariable(StmtsAwareInterface $stmtsAware, int $key): Variable|null
{
$nextStmt = $stmtsAware->stmts[$key + 1] ?? null;
// last item → stop
if ($nextStmt === null) {
return null;
}
if (! $nextStmt instanceof Return_) {
return null;
}
// next return must be variable
if (! $nextStmt->expr instanceof Variable) {
return null;
}
return $nextStmt->expr;
}
}
